Houston, Texas – Just a quick trip from Houston, the Alamo City comes alive this time of year with events and experiences.
If you can’t wait to rodeo in Houston, the San Antonio Stock Show & Rodeo is happening now through March 7th.
San Antonio is also honoring Black history with meaningful community events, art showcases, cultural programming, and educational experiences throughout February.
For St. Patrick’s Day, the famous San Antonio River Walk transforms into a sea of emerald as the river is dyed bright green. Expect festive parades, live music, and plenty of reasons to celebrate along the water.
Animal lovers can visit the gorillas at the San Antonio Zoo, home to one of the top zoo experiences in Texas.
And for a truly special stop, Morgan’s Wonderland offers a one-of-a-kind, ultra-accessible theme park designed for guests of all abilities, a beautiful reminder that fun should be for everyone.
At Six Flags Fiesta Texas, spring means Mardi Gras celebrations packed with parades, themed entertainment, beads, and bold flavors, plus all the roller coasters your adrenaline-loving friends can handle.
History buffs, take note: The Alamo is undergoing a massive, multi-year renovation and museum expansion, creating a more immersive experience that honors Texas history in a powerful new way.
The Shops at Rivercenter continues to evolve with new dining options, including the culinary space “Mexico Ceaty,” bringing bold, authentic flavors to the heart of downtown.
Whether you’re craving culture, coaster thrills, meaningful history, or margaritas by the water, San Antonio in the spring delivers it all with Texas charm and a whole lot of personality.
